Accessing the Online Product Manual

The LifeKeeper Online Product Manual is included in the steeleye-lkHLP software package. The Product Manual is HTML-based, and accessed from a web browser. Once the Product Manual is installed, "help" topics are accessible from the Table of Contents in the Help menu of the LifeKeeper GUI. Context-sensitive Help is accessible from "Help" buttons within the GUI dialog boxes.

The Online Product Manual can be accessed outside the GUI by opening the URL for the GUI product manual web page, http://[server name]:81/help/lksstart.htm, directly from your browser.

Note: The Online Product Manual requires a web server for client browser communication. Installation of the LifeKeeper GUI will install and configure a public domain web server, mhttpd, using port 81.

Right Pane

The right pane displays the individual topics.  There are four buttons at the top of each topic:

       

Click the  (Previous) and  (Next) buttons that are located at the top of each topic to browse topics appearing in a predefined sequence. Topics may also contain links to related topics.

Click your browser’s Back button to go to the last topic viewed.

Click the  button to hide the left navigation pane if you want more viewing space for the topics, or click the  button to show the left navigation pane when it is in the hidden state.

If you have arrived at a topic by a method other than selecting from the Table of Contents, you can re-synchronize the "help" file to show where you are in the Table of Contents by clicking .
